Barbara Schäuble is a scholar working on Psychiatry and Mental health,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Barbara Schäuble has authored 73 papers receiving a total of 2.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 55 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health, 13 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and 12 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Barbara Schäuble’s work include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(20 papers), Epilepsy research and treatment (17 papers) and Pharmacological Effects and Toxicity Studies (13 papers). Barbara Schäuble is often cited by papers focused on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(20 papers), Epilepsy research and treatment (17 papers) and Pharmacological Effects and Toxicity Studies (13 papers). Barbara Schäuble coll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Switzerland. Barbara Schäuble's co-authors include K. Rettig, A. Schreiner, Paul Kleihues, Ute Richarz and J. J. Sandra Kooij and has published in prestigious journals such as Neurology, Journal of the American Geriatrics Society and International Journal of Cancer.
